Dunnock, UK
Picture comes from our May trip to Wales, this one particularly from Newborough Warren National Nature Reserve in Llanddwyn. Dunnock are pretty shy birds and quite rarely seen and hard to approach, this one seemed to feel OK with us standing some 8 meters from it...
